The compressibility of hexagonal graphite-like boron nitride has been
measured at room temperature up to 12 GPa, using a diamond anvil cell
and X-ray scattering with synchrotron radiation. From the obtained pre
ssure-volume relation for hBN the isothermal bulk modulus of 36.7+/-0.
5 GPa and its first pressure derivative of 5.6+/-0.2 have been calcula
ted.
